TORRINGTON – Family and friends of Harold Eugene “Gene” Evans, 68, of Torrington are invited to a memorial gathering at 3 p.m., Nov. 17, 2017, at the VFW Hall in Torrington.

Gene passed away Oct. 23, 2017, at the VA Medical Center in Cheyenne following a year-long battle with cancer. Per Gene’s request, cremation has taken place.

Gene was born in Rogers, Ark., on Nov. 25, 1948, the son of Clarence and Winnie (Edmonson) Evans. The family moved to Huntley in 1952. Gene was graduated from Goshen Hole High School on May 18, 1967, and went on to study at Wyoming Tech in Laramie
in 1968.

After graduating, Gene was drafted into the U.S. Army. He was initially station at Fort Bliss, Texas, and later sent to South Korea for advanced training.

Gene was married to Willmeta “Willy” Hanson on Jan. 2, 1982. The couple had two sons, Brandyne and Boyd Evans, both of Torrington. Gene and Willy were divorced in 1991 and then remarried in December 1993.

Gene was a mechanic by trade, priding himself on being fair and honest. He worked at Stickney’s from 1978 to 1986, then at Tri-State Tire for one year before moving to Terry’s Tire Shop in 1988. After leaving Terry’s, he opened his own business, Gene’s
Auto Repair.
